Timeline controls are not working in Adobe express when you duplicate a file.

  • December 4, 2024
  • 3 replies
  • 393 views

If you create an animated file in Adobe express and create a duplicate file of the same. The timeline control options - Adjust clip duration stops working.

Correct answer Amitej S

Hi @Paula34235765me08, I tried replicating the issue mentioned, and it worked fine for me. Can you please share a screen recording with us so we can better understand the issue and the workflow? Also, please ensure you've toggled on the 'Show layer timing' button.

Hi Amitej,

 

Thanks for your response. It's working now, I didn't realise that the 'Show layer timing' button was disabled in the duplicate file.
